해결된 질문
작성
·
75
0
안녕하세요 1.3) 실습용 백엔드 서버 세팅 이후 terminal 에서 npm run start 로 Swagger UI 까지 작동이 되었는데요. 2.1) Page Outer를 소개합니다. 에서 npx create-next-app@14 section02
를 진행하고 나면, npm run start 시 에러가 나고 있습니다. SSR 강의를 진행하면서 계속해서 백엔드 서버에 접속을 못하는데 왜 이러는 걸까요? error 사진파일 첨부하였습니다.
답변 2
0
안녕하세요 이정환입니다.
현재 프로젝트에 타입스크립트 설정 관련 오류가 존재하는 걸로 보입니다. 혹시 tsconfig.json이나 eslint.config.ts 파일을 수정하신 이력이 있으신가요? 혹은 넥스트 앱 생성시에 뭔가 다른 선택지를 입력하신건 아닌지 체크해보시면 좋을 듯 합니다.
방금 아래와 같이 확인해 본 결과 npx create-next-app@14 명령으로 생성한 넥스트 앱에는 문제가 없는 걸로 확인되었습니다.
Winterlood 🐼 ~/Documents/lab/section02 main
npm run build
> section02@0.1.0 build
> next build
▲ Next.js 14.2.3
✓ Linting and checking validity of types
Creating an optimized production build ...
✓ Compiled successfully
✓ Collecting page data
✓ Generating static pages (3/3)
✓ Collecting build traces
✓ Finalizing page optimization
Route (pages) Size First Load JS
┌ ○ / 4.94 kB 83.1 kB
├ └ css/e7e46e3ce921208e.css 1.78 kB
├ /_app 0 B 78.2 kB
├ ○ /404 182 B 78.4 kB
└ ƒ /api/hello 0 B 78.2 kB
+ First Load JS shared by all 78.9 kB
├ chunks/framework-ecc4130bc7a58a64.js 45.2 kB
├ chunks/main-48a2be0192cdda09.js 32 kB
└ other shared chunks (total) 1.75 kB
○ (Static) prerendered as static content
ƒ (Dynamic) server-rendered on demand
Winterlood 🐼 ~/Documents/lab/section02 main
npm run start
> section02@0.1.0 start
> next start
▲ Next.js 14.2.3
- Local: http://localhost:3000
✓ Starting...
✓ Ready in 167ms
정확한 문제 원인 파악을 위해서는 전체 프로젝트 코드가 다 필요한 상황인데요 GitHub 또는 구글 드라이브 링크로 전달 주시면 확인해보겠습니다.
0
안녕하세요, 인프런 AI 인턴입니다. Jin님.
Next.js 프로젝트를 생성하고 npm run start
명령어 실행 시 에러가 발생하는 문제에 대해 설명드리겠습니다. 제공해주신 이미지와 설명을 바탕으로 문제가 JSX 파일을 처리할 때 발생하는 TypeScript 설정 오류로 보입니다.
에러 메시지에서 “JSX에 대해 --jsx
플래그가 제공되지 않았다”는 내용이 보입니다. 이는 TypeScript 파일에서 JSX 구문을 사용할 때, 올바른 컴파일 옵션이 설정되지 않아 발생하는 오류입니다.
tsconfig.json
파일을 열어 compilerOptions
섹션에 jsx
옵션이 설정되어 있는지 확인해야 합니다.jsx
옵션은 react
혹은 react-jsx
로 설정됩니다. {
"compilerOptions": {
"jsx": "react-jsx"
}
}
Next.js 설정 확인하기:
tsconfig.json
이 적절히 생성되지 않은 경우, npx typescript --init
명령어로 기본 설정 파일을 생성해 보세요.프로젝트 초기화 시 설정 확인하기:
npx create-next-app@14 section02
실행 시, 추가 설정이 필요한지 재확인해보세요. 설치와 초기화 과정에서 오류가 발생하지 않았는지 확인합니다.관련하여 유사한 질문들이 해결된 사례가 있는 링크를 추가로 제공드립니다:
- “Next.js 프로젝트 설정 시 TypeScript 오류 발생”
이런 설정들을 점검하신 후에도 문제가 여전히 해결되지 않는다면, 추가적인 설정 파일이나 오류 메시지를 공유해 주세요. 최대한 도움을 드릴 수 있도록 하겠습니다.
저는 질문자님의 이해를 돕고자 지식공유자님의 기존 답변을 참고하여 유사한 답변 링크를 추천해드리고 있습니다.
현재 베타 기능으로 답변이 만족스럽지 않을 수 있는 점 양해 부탁드립니다. 🙏
추가적으로 궁금한 점이 있으시면, 이어서 질문해 주세요. 곧 지식공유자께서 답변해 주실 것입니다.